Top AI Tools Transforming the Developer Workflow in 2025

Are you pursuing b tech artificial intelligence and considering job roles in software development? Expertise in AI tools is a must-have skill to do so in the current ever-evolving AI era and its integration across industries and departments, including software development. Numerous AI tools are available in the market, and it is pretty overwhelming to decide which is better for your specific learning and industry needs.

We crawled the web and shortlisted the top AI tools you must understand and develop expertise in for a promising career in high-tech artificial intelligence. For a premier institute to pursue your dreams, we suggest Chanakya University. Visit the website to learn why.

Let’s proceed with the top AI tools for your quick reference.

AI Tools for Augmented Software Development: Coders’ All-Season Assistant

GitHub Copilot

GitHub Copilot is an AI-powered coding assistant that supports multiple programming languages such as C++, TypeScript, Python, JavaScript, and Go. Trained on extensive datasets from public code repositories and other sources, it can generate helpful code suggestions. Copilot also helps identify poor coding practices and offers recommendations for improvement.

Features

  • Code generation and navigating through programming languages and frameworks
  • AI-based suggestions and multiple integrations
  • Supports code editors such as Visual Studio Code, JetBrain’s IDE, and Neovim
  • Supports faster code completion

Tabnine

Tabnine offers code suggestions and autocompletion features that help developers write high-quality code more efficiently. Powered by large language models trained on extensive open-source codebases, Tabnine analyses code in real time to detect mistakes and errors as they occur. This proactive approach reduces the need for later revisions, allowing developers to maintain error-free code as they write.

Chanakya University, the best private university in India, offers world-class labs and education facilities where students can practice advanced AI tools and development methodologies. Explore now for btech admission.

Features

  • Customised code and suggestions
  • Accurate code completion as per the prompts given
  • IDE integration with popular editors such as IntelliJ, PhpStorm, Android Studio, VS Code, and Eclipse
  • Technical documentation and unit test generation
  • Supports multiple programming languages

OpenAI Codex

OpenAI Codex is a versatile AI model that translates natural language instructions into code. Beyond code generation, it assists with tasks such as reviewing code, creating technical documentation, adding comments to code, converting comments into executable code, and discovering relevant APIs and libraries. While proficient in Python, OpenAI Codex also offers some support for languages like Swift, Perl, and PHP.

  • Code refactoring and code linting
  • Informational retrieval and language translation
  • Fine-tuning and data analysis

Sourcegraph

Sourcegraph, an AI-enhanced coding platform, streamlines the process of writing, editing, and reviewing code. With features like Cody for code creation and maintenance, and Code Search for comprehensive codebase navigation from a single point, it boosts developer productivity. Sourcegraph also offers in-IDE assistance by answering technical questions and generating contextually relevant code.

Programmers prefer this for large codebase management. Its core features include;

  • Code exploration, auto completion
  • Auto-generation of unit tests
  • AI-powered chat
  • Vulnerability detection

Replit

Replit is a leading platform for collaborative coding. Its online editor features an AI assistant for code writing and application deployment. The platform supports over twenty programming languages, including Kotlin, Rust, Golang, HTML, CSS, Haskell, R, and Elixir, facilitating seamless teamwork.

Other Leading AI Tools for Software Development

  • Codinga
  • Sourcery
  • Synk
  • Hugging Face
  • Amazon SageMaker

Conclusion

Integrating AI tools can enhance productivity and the quality of the final product. These tools minimise errors, speed up development processes by automating manual tasks, and power up the developer’s workflow. Learn about the latest AI tools for software development at Chanakya University, among the top universities in India for engineering, and become future-ready developers with AI skills. Let the magic of AI+HI unleash. 

Reference Link

https://www.upwork.com/resources/best-ai-coding-tools#:~:text=1.,and%20provide%20tips%20for%20improvement.&text=%E2%80%8DFeatures:,integrated%20development%20environment%20(IDEs).

Join our
purpose

Join hand with us today! Extend your support to develop Global Vision.

Support Chanakya

Choose Chanakya for Learning through Experience for a Life of Excellence.

Apply as Student

Join us to lead a Culture of Learning and Leadership.

Apply as faculty